While simple, this implementation has 2 problems: 1) Only the priority level of the completed request is considered. However, writes to a zone may be blocked due to other writes to the same zone using a different priority level. While this is unlikely to happen in practice, as writing a zone with different IO priorirites does not make sense, nothing in the code prevents this from happening. 2) The use of list_empty() is dangerous as dd_finish_request() does not take dd->lock and may run concurrently with the insert and dispatch code. Fix these 2 problems by testing the write fifo list of all priority levels using the new helper dd_has_write_work(), and by testing each fifo list using list_empty_careful().
